Books 2014 Vol. 8 – “The Sealed Letter” by Emma Donoghue [Weekend Post]

Swathy · September 21, 2014 · Leave a Comment

the sealed letter by emma donoghue book review

I love sensational novels. I think we all love sensationalism. We thrive on it, in fact. That is what makes the city times and page 3 circulated far more than the regular newspapers get read. So, when I came across the book, I instantly knew I wanted to read it.
The book is based on the famous divorce case, Henry Codrington vs Helen Condrington, of 1864 in England on the grounds of infidelity on part of the wife, Helen. It was the time when women empowerment movement was gathering quite a bit of attention and Emily Faithfull, a major player in the above divorce case, was an active member of the movement.
The Plot
Emily Faithfull encounters Helen one day on her way to the press. And, that leads to bittersweet reconciliation between two long lost friends. As the story moves on, we and Emily both get to know that Helen’s cavalier, Col. Anderson, and Helen are having a hushed affair and Emily is a unsuspecting promoter of this affair. 
Helen portrays herself as an ill-used wife of Henry Codrington and a devoted mother of her two girls. While the latter was true to a degree, the first was a twisted version of the reality. The relationship between Codrington and his wife had reached to a cooling degree of affection but it was as much the responsibility of the flirtatious wife as much as the aloof husband. 

the sealed letter by emma donoghue book review

But, till a telegram of importance does not get answered to by Helen does Henry think his wife to be cheating on him. Once the suspicion gets rooted, Henry employs a detective to follow his wife and report her movements. Everything was above reproach till she makes a slip and what follows is the infamous courtroom drama. 
To secure her side of the witness, Helen again ropes in Emily to give a testimony against Henry by taking advantage of Emily’s guileless nature.
My Verdict
I could see a lot of parallels from Anna Karenina but the way Helen has been portrayed as compared to the classic heroine is very different. Helen ends up being shown a manipulator and a deceiver, Henry Codrington comes across as a victimized husband and Emily Faithfull is a foolish instrument, dangerous in intelligent hands!!
The book slows a bit at times but it has rave reviews in GoodReads. Feel free to skip or skim some pages and decide for yourself if you would like it. I would say it comes across as a decent read but then you would not miss anything if you do not come across the book.

Shea Butter Face Cream

Le Beurre Shea Butter Face Cream and Lip Balm product review
  • Price: 12$ for 2oz
  • No smell at all. 
  • Packaging not really great. In fact the labels also get dissolved if the shea butter melts on it. 
  • Moisturizes well. Shea Butter is awesome. In fact, it made my skin look glowing and hydrated even if no exfoliation was done!
  • Ingredients not mentioned. 
  • Does not travel well. The cream can melt in tropical temperatures and leak! 
  • A small quantity is enough. Otherwise, it will make the face look oily. And, it is definitely a winter or dry season product. 
  • Not suited for oily skin. 
Loving It / Using It : Using It
Le Beurre Shea Butter Face Cream and Lip Balm product review

Shea Butter Lip Butter
  • Price: 3$ for 0.5oz
  • No smell at all. 
  • Packaging good. The tin can can be reused for homemade lip balms or solid perfumes. 
  • Moisturises well. Shea Butter is awesome. Lips look pink and beautiful.
  • Ingredients not mentioned. 
  • Absolutely travel-friendly
Loving It / Using It : Loving It
Le Beurre Shea Butter Face Cream and Lip Balm product review

Availability
Website – Le Beurre
Overall Verdict
Totally love the lip butter. Definitely recommended! For face cream, I had only a sample size so can not really comment more.

5 Veggies that help with Acne {Five Series}

Swathy · September 17, 2014 · 3 Comments

So, I was checking through my drafts and I came across this post which I had written long back and just left it as it is. So, let me recount some of the rarely heard home remedies which have great affect on the bacteria which result in acne.
Cabbage
It is rich in Vitamin K and Vitamin C, both of which help in getting a glowing and radiant skin and they also fight hyper-pigmentation. Grate a piece of cabbage and extract its juice. Apply it topically, let it dry and wash off. And, it also helps flushing out the toxins when taken internally.
Radish
Radish is rich in ascorbic acid, which is one form of Vitamin C, and potassium,  whose deficiency can cause acne and Vitamin A and K. It helps fight the inflammation in the skin.

Onion
Rich in Vitamin C. And, 

Onions contain phytochemical compounds such as phenolics and flavonoids that basic research shows to have potential anti-inflammatory, anti-cholesterol, anticancer and antioxidant properties [Source].

Cucumber
Rich in Vitamin A, C, E and K and potassium. And, helps soothe the skin. It is an astringent which helps open the skin pores and clean them.
Beetroot
Rich in Vitamin A, potassium, magnesium and Vitamin E which helps heal the scars on the skin. It helps clearing the skin from the inside and flushes out the toxins and also helps lower cholesterol.
